Edinburg, TX. – At least one person was injured in a multi-vehicle crash on Monday afternoon in Edinburg.
According to the Texas Department of Public Safety, the crash happened at the intersection of Monte Cristo and Closner at around 4 p.m.
A white semi-truck was traveling southbound on Closner entered the intersection and struck a Toyota Camry, a tuck tractor, a Ford Bronco, and a Nissan.
One person sustained injuries and was transported to the hospital.
More details about the crash were not provided.
An investigation into the crash is ongoing.
